Good Day先生,我有一个可以将视频保存在文件夹中的Media Player项目。 我做了一个可以浏览文件的按钮,所以我使用openfiledialog并选择了一个 视频,视频的文件路径位于我创建的文本框中,因此这是我的代码:
private void button3_Click(object sender, EventArgs e)
{
OpenFileDialog openFileDialog1 = new OpenFileDialog();
if (openFileDialog1.ShowDialog() == System.Windows.Forms.DialogResult.OK)
{
this.textBox1.Text = openFileDialog1.FileName;
}
}
我的问题是我选择的视频是我希望它保存在我命名的文件夹(savevideo)中。你能帮我解决这个问题吗?
答案 0 :(得分:0)
我认为你需要这样的东西:
private void button3_Click(object sender, EventArgs e)
{
OpenFileDialog openFileDialog1 = new OpenFileDialog();
if (openFileDialog1.ShowDialog() == System.Windows.Forms.DialogResult.OK)
{
this.textBox1.Text = openFileDialog1.FileName;
File.Copy(openFileDialog1.FileName,
Path.Combine(savevideo, Path.GetFileName(openFileDialog1.FileName)));
}
}
Path.Combine位根据您的“savevideo”路径和原始文件的名称组合,构建要复制到的新文件名。